
Ministry of Environment and Forestry
The Ministry of Environment and Forestry is a government department responsible for protecting the environment, managing natural resources, and conserving forests. It develops policies to reduce pollution, promote sustainable use of land and water, and preserve biodiversity. The ministry also regulates activities like logging, mining, and industrial development to ensure they do not harm ecosystems. Its goal is to balance economic growth with environmental preservation, ensuring a healthy planet for current and future generations.
